Integration of Kyrgyz Language Proficiency in Academic and Professional Development

In Osh State University, Kyrgyz language courses for postgraduates were held for the first time. Approximately 60 postgraduates participated in the 20-hour training. Over the course of a month, postgraduates underwent training in groups focusing on writing, reading, and speaking. As a result, everyone took a test covering 1. vocabulary, grammar, and writing; 2. listening; 3. reading; 4. speaking, organized by "Kyrgyztest."

In recent years, postgraduate students are required to pass the Kyrgyztest and obtain a special certificate before defending their dissertations. Preparation for the test is conducted not only in educational institutions but also extends to employees of institutions and enterprises who are also required to take the Kyrgyztest.
